DIGITAL TRANSFORMATION

Digital transformation refers to the integration of digital technologies into various aspects of an organization, resulting in fundamental changes to how it operates and delivers value to its customers. It involves utilizing digital tools and technologies to streamline processes, enhance efficiency, improve decision-making, and create new business models.

2. Improving operational efficiency

Automation and digitization of processes can streamline operations, reduce manual effort, and enhance productivity. This can lead to cost savings and faster time-to-market.

3. Enabling data-driven decision-making

By collecting and analyzing data from various sources, organizations can gain valuable insights into customer behavior, market trends, and operational performance. This data-driven approach helps in making informed decisions and identifying new opportunities.

4. Fostering innovation

Digital transformation encourages organizations to embrace a culture of innovation, enabling them to explore new business models, products, and services. It promotes experimentation and agility in response to evolving market dynamics.

5. Empowering employees

Digital technologies can equip employees with tools and platforms that enhance collaboration, communication, and knowledge sharing. It can also automate routine tasks, freeing up time for more strategic and value-added activities.

It's important to note that digital transformation is not just about technology adoption but also involves organizational and cultural changes. It requires leadership commitment, employee engagement, and a willingness to adapt to new ways of working. Successful digital transformation can have a profound impact on an organization's competitiveness, growth, and ability to thrive in the digital age.
